What Exactly Is an Exercise Modality, and Why Does It Matter?


Understanding Your Fitness Goals


When you start an exercise program, it’s crucial to identify your goals. Are you aiming to lose weight, build muscle, or train for a specific sport? Once you've pinpointed your purpose, the next step is to explore the right exercise program to achieve these goals.

What Is an Exercise Modality?


An exercise modality is simply a particular form or method of exercise intended to produce a specific result. For instance:

- Aerobics: Often used to burn fat and improve cardiovascular endurance.
- Weight Training: Used to increase muscle size and strength.
- Yoga: Focuses on enhancing the mind-body connection and improving energy and awareness.

With countless exercise modalities out there, and new ones emerging all the time, there’s a wide array of options for anyone seeking to improve their fitness.

Why Should You Care?


Understanding and experimenting with different exercise modalities is crucial for a few reasons:

1. Adaptation: Your body may adapt to your routine, reducing its effectiveness over time.
2. Comprehensive Fitness: A single modality might not cover all aspects of good health, such as strength, cardio, flexibility, balance, and neuromuscular coordination.

For sustainable health and fitness, it’s vital to incorporate various exercise modalities into your routine. Relying solely on one type?"whether it's weightlifting or yoga?"isn't enough for long-term wellness.

Breaking the Monotony


Variety is essential. Avoid dismissing certain exercises as uninteresting or irrelevant. For instance, Pilates isn’t just for those seeking low-impact workouts, and weightlifting isn’t just for building bulk. Exploring new exercise modalities can prevent monotony and help maintain your fitness motivation.

Keep an Open Mind


Don’t limit yourself by adhering strictly to a single form of exercise. Trying new activities opens doors to enriched experiences and enhances your overall quality of life.

Who knows? You might even discover a new favorite way to stay active! Embrace the possibilities, and your fitness journey will be all the more rewarding.
